Lynch Expected to Return to U.S. Today

Pfc. Jessica Lynch, the prisoner of war rescued by U.S. troops in Iraq, has made steady progress and is to return to the United States today from the U.S. military hospital in Landstuhl, Germany, officials said.

Lynch, 19, of Palestine, W.Va., is to go to the Walter Reed Army Medical Center in Washington. She was captured March 23 after her 507th Ordnance Maintenance Company convoy was attacked near Nasiriyah. She is being treated for a head wound, a spinal injury and fractures to her right arm, both legs, and her right foot and ankle.
